Billing function
Hi.
What about some billing function in ISPConfig ?
Thank you.

The billing function is on the 42go ISP Manager version. It's removed in ISPConfig and i think it will not be enabled in the future.

I was planning on writing a billing manager for ISPConfig, as mentioned when I asked for CVS access. Now obviously I'm free to do this on my installation, but I would like to give back to the open source project.
Is there any objection from the point of view that this is in 42go? Given it's in 42go already, would it make sense to make the two compatible for any clients that want to upgrade to 42go?
Is there already an upgrade path from ISPComplete to 42go? If not, then the ability to migrate billing data is not so important.
I would like to seek any comments on this before I start so I can take all input into account. Please let me know if:
- you have any concerns about the development of this feature
- you have any requirements or suggestions for this feature
- you know how you'd write it and want to give me the benefit of your ideas
- you want to help

we appreciate your effort. We will support it by donating the current code from the 42go billing system to the ISPConfig project.
Currently the release of ISPConfig 2.1.1 is in progress, we will upload the code in the SVN repository after 2.1.1 the release.

The code of the billing system is now available in SVN. The code is not tested yet and the integration of the invoice plugin in the Web form is still issing. I will will have a look at these parts in the next few days.
